Output d335496fd1bf44755de40407ea73421f77923786576f8e4acfa7c0bcb0e48fe1:1
- value
- 18337910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c9481d4bf69326637a47caaf20f37180bc40782 OP_EQUAL
- address
- 3Jt8s4mML1D1Rvrda3Hch5LqBEcBvef7rE
- transaction
- d335496fd1bf44755de40407ea73421f77923786576f8e4acfa7c0bcb0e48fe1
- confirmations
- 448600
- spent
- true